What Can The Letters BILLETTY Mean?

These are the meanings of the letters BILLETTY when you unscramble them.

  • Billet (n.)
    A bearing in the form of an oblong rectangle.
  • Billet (n.)
    A loop which receives the end of a buckled strap.
  • Billet (n.)
    A short bar of metal, as of gold or iron.
  • Billet (n.)
    A small paper; a note; a short letter.
  • Billet (n.)
    A small stick of wood, as for firewood.
  • Billet (n.)
    A strap which enters a buckle.
  • Billet (n.)
    A ticket from a public officer directing soldiers at what house to lodge; as, a billet of residence.
  • Billet (n.)
    An ornament in Norman work, resembling a billet of wood either square or round.
  • Billet (v. t.)
    To direct, by a ticket or note, where to lodge. Hence: To quarter, or place in lodgings, as soldiers in private houses.
